Zusammenfassung

Die Geschichte von Twin Sector spielt in einer postapokalyptischen Zukunft, in der die Überreste der Menschheit in kryogenen Kammern tief unter der verseuchten Oberfläche der Erde in einen künstlichen Schlaf versetzt wurden - bis der Planet wieder bewohnbar wird. Als Spieler schlüpfen Sie in die Rolle von Ashley Simms, dem Protagonisten von Twin Sector.

Plötzlich werden Sie vom Sicherheitssystem der Station, O.S.C.A.R., geweckt und sehen sich mit der drohenden Auslöschung aller anderen noch schlafenden Überlebenden konfrontiert, die auf einen unbekannten Fehler im Lebenserhaltungssystem zurückzuführen ist. Laut O.S.C.A.R. sind Sie die einzige Person, die geweckt werden konnte, und somit das einzige Individuum, das die Menschheit retten kann. Innerhalb der nächsten zehn Stunden müssen Sie den defekten Hauptgenerator des unterirdischen Bunkersystems reparieren, um die Funktionsfähigkeit der Station wiederherzustellen. Aber es gibt noch unbekannte Kräfte, die um jeden Preis verhindern wollen, dass Ihnen das gelingt.

Twin Sector ist ein spannendes, physikbasiertes Action-Adventure, das dem Spieler die freie Interaktion mit seiner Umgebung ermöglicht. Mit den Vorteilen der leistungsstarken HAVOK-Engine warten unzählige Rätsel, Herausforderungen und Gegner in einer feindlichen und bedrohlichen futuristischen Umgebung auf die Spieler.

This game had potential however poor level design, a lack of direction, insane fall damage, and check points that are few and far between inThis game had potential however poor level design, a lack of direction, insane fall damage, and check points that are few and far between in certain areas make it a chore to play. Im a completionist so i finished the game however it took around 6-8 hours altogether with probably 10% of that being loading time, and about 50% being spent speed running through sections of puzzles I had already completed after being sent back to a distant check point upon death. This game could have easily been a great puzzle game however the developers need to put a little more thought in there level layout(a lot of just giant U turn hallways with cage dividers serving no purpose other then to waste time), damage settings(falling 5+ feet is a instant death if you dont catch yourself), and the check point layout(the lack of many check points in parts of the game made it very unforgiving and time consuming).
